> What else should I expect when it comes to these auditions? Should I bring a
> prepared solo? Can I audition for both, or do I have to choose one?
> If you will mail your excerpt books, my address is:

Prepared solo - Mozart, mvt 1 (exposition) and mvt 2 (all)
Maybe a movement of the Stravinsky 3 Pieces (3rd mvt)
